The range of games that we can also enjoy on our Apple computers is constantly expanding, mainly thanks to the publishers from Feral Interactive, who are constantly supplying us with new additions to our game libraries. The latest venture that we will play on macOS precisely thanks to Feral is the fantastic story adventure Life is Strange: Before the Storm. The award-winning game is thus a year after its official release on PC and Xbox consoles One and PS4 also gets on apple computers. The fantastic addition to the well-known universe from the Square Enix workshop also made its way to our editorial office, where we tested it and compared it with versions for other platforms.

An atmospheric story that will win you over
As you may already know, in the game we will dive into the story in which the 16-year-old rebel Chloe Price will play the main role. During the story, we will meet another important protagonist, Rachel Amber, who is known to all fans of the first part. When Rachel learns about a hidden family secret, it is Chloe who gives her the strength and determination to continue. During the individual episodes, you identify with the main character, thanks to which you immerse yourself not only in the main idea of the game, but also in everyday practices, family and friendship relationships. In the skin of Chloe, you get to the core by constantly exploring based on the interaction with the surrounding environment, individual objects and people. The characteristic graphic processing is complemented by a perfect soundtrack, which will not tire you even after several rounds of the title. All episodes (along with the bonus Farewell episode) are constructed in a very emotional way, thanks to which you get into the story much deeper than in the case of classic story adventures.
In the game, you will meet the main character Chloe, as well as other characters throughout the story.
There are also references to other pop-culture elements in the game minigames or diversions from the main story. If you get tired of overcoming the primary storyline for a while, you can still have fun looking for various references in the form of "easter eggs" to other game titles and not only within this series. All events (or at least most) are completely tied to the further development of the game, so it is necessary to think carefully about your next steps and take all the facts into account.
Why play a game on a Mac?
I personally played the game on several platforms, but the macOS version impressed me the most. As a console player, I prefer control with a gamepad, but in this case I'm very happy to make an exception. The game is perfectly adapted for control like s trackpadom, so also with the help Magic Mouse 2. Of course, there is no need to comment on the adaptation for higher-order gaming mice. However, do not forget to adjust the intensity of the mouse movement speed, as the preset option is (at least for my taste) very slow and in some cases you will be waving the mouse around head and neck unnecessarily. Despite the fact that in the case of games from the Life is Strange universe, it is not a graphical experience like other leading AAA titles, the rendering of colors is very solid and the overall processing has an attractive and interesting impression. If you prefer to play with a game controller, don't forget to change this option in the menu.
The game also includes interactions with surrounding objects, based on which a large amount of information about the story can be learned.
Verdict
If you are not familiar with the Life is Strange universe and are planning to join this adventure carousel, now is the right time. With the recent arrival of Life is Strange: Before the Storm, the offer of titles immediately expands to a pair of representatives of the universe, as in App Store (or on official website of Feral Interactive) you can also find the original Life is Strange game. The addition in the form of The Awesome Adventures of Captain Spirit is still missing on Macs, but that could change over time. At the moment, however, we can witness the gradual release of episodes of Life is Strange 2, which, according to the current scenario, should appear on macOS during the next year. This adaptation was announced just a week ago by the Feral group.
Before the Storm is not the latest effort, but thanks to the optimization for Mac, fans are offered a new opportunity for a unique gaming experience. There are few games on the Apple platform that stand out with a similar atmosphere and engaging story as the Life is Strange series. Perfect control, an intuitive interface and, above all, a decent amount of breathtaking plot will serve every serious gamer, as well as the occasional player, plenty of fun. You can enjoy Life is Strange: Before the Storm on the following Macs:
- Mac Mini 2014 and newer
- 13" MacBook Pro 2013 and newer
- 15" MacBook Pro 2012 with a 1GB graphics card and newer
- (2015 models with AMD 370X are not supported)
- 21.5″ iMac 2013 and later
- 27″ iMac 2013 and later
- (2012 models with Nvidia 675 or Nvidia 680 cards are also supported)
- 27" iMac Pro 2017
- Mac Pro 2013 and newer
